After the roadside treat at Annaghmore (County Leitrim) I didn't know what to expect here, but the usual practice of visiting roadside sites with a pessimistic approach avoid the disappointment that would have ensued had I expected another Anskert.

Dotted around the copse are some stones that really do not help you to determine the layout of the tomb. There are traces of cairn, kerb, gallery and court if you really take the time to study them, but frankly I wouldn't realy recommend this to anyone. This site really is not very interesting at all.
